I have the chance of a 2.0 mk1 Mondeo engine for my mk6 escort which at the moment is a 1.4cvh but has coil park not the other kind coil. The Mondeo engine comes with rs1800 ecu and engine loom .

 

The question is can I use my engine loom or put the rs1800 loom in . And should I change my fuel pump as I'm guessing the 1.4 pump won't handle the 2.0 .

 

 

Any comments welcome

The way I've done it is change the loom and fuse box to one from a zetec. The pump should be fine because they run the same fuel pressure as far as I'm aware. Then use the guide on here to change the pin outs...but that's for a 2.0 ecu. I've just done this conversion and it's pretty straight forward once you get your head round it

The turbo conversion whilst slightly more expensive and slightly more involved is a good road to go down if your going to be doing this much work to the car, that said changing looms isnt really that hard (but go to a standard zetec escort loom and stick a 2.0 (DEEP,DESK,DALE,DEWY) ECU in there
